Driving License Categories in Poland
Before diving into the details, it's essential to comprehend the various classes of driving licenses readily available in Poland. Here's a breakdown:

| License Category | Lorry Type | Minimum Age |
|---|---|---|
| AM | Mopeds (as much as 50cc) | 14 |
| A1 | Bikes (up to 125cc) | 16 |
| A2 | Motorcycles (up to 400cc) | 18 |
| A | Unlimited motorcycles | 24 or 20 with 2 years of A2 |
| B | Automobiles (as much as 3.5 loads) and light trucks | 18 |
| C | Trucks (over 3.5 tons) | 21 |
| D | Buses | 24 |
| E | Trailers over 750 kg | 18 (with B, C, or D) |

Duration and Cost of Polish Driving Lessons
The length and cost of driving lessons can vary substantially based on the driving school and the kind of lessons taken. Below is a table summing up approximated periods and expenses:
| Component | Period (Hours) | Estimated Cost (Zloty) |
|---|---|---|
| Theoretical Course | 30 | 400 - 600 |
| Practical Lessons | 30 - 40 | 2,000 - 3,000 |
| Exam Fees | 200 - 300 | 200 - 300 |
| Overall Estimated Cost | 60 - 70 | 2,600 - 3,900 |

List of Common FAQs
1. What is the minimum age to begin driving lessons in Poland?
The minimum age to start driving lessons varies by license category. For a guest vehicle license (Category B), it's 18 years.
2. Are driving schools in Poland taught in English?
Lots of driving schools provide lessons in English, particularly in larger cities or tourist areas. It's recommended to validate this with the school before registration.
3. Can international students take driving lessons in Poland?
Yes, international trainees can take driving lessons, however they might require to supply extra documentation, such as proof of residency and a foreign driving permit if they hold one.
